CFNJ 99.1 Saint-Gabriel-de-Brandon, QC online radio

CFNJ 99.1 Saint-Gabriel-de-Brandon, QC is an online radio station that offers a wide range of programming to its listeners. With a focus on local news, events, and community involvement, CFNJ aims to provide a voice for the people of Saint-Gabriel-de-Brandon and the surrounding area.
The station features a diverse range of music, including a mix of popular hits from various genres and eras. Listeners can tune in to enjoy their favorite songs or discover new ones as they explore the station's playlists.
In addition to music, CFNJ also offers a variety of talk shows and interviews, covering topics such as current events, sports, health, and more. The station strives to keep its listeners informed and engaged, providing a platform for discussions and debates on issues that matter to the community.
CFNJ prides itself on being highly involved with the local community. It regularly promotes local events and initiatives, supporting the arts, charity organizations, and local businesses.
